The essential premise of the game is to play against your opponents and either colonize or build 12 planets or structures, or to get as much money as you can. The fun comes in combining your cards to stack up bonuses from "6-cost Developments," which function like Wonders in a Civilization game. The game has been described as "Poker meets Alpha Centauri," "A race to see who can play Patience the fastest" and "[[Citadels]] meets Sins of a Solar Empire," and has two expansions coming out soon which deal with the mysterious "Imperial," "Uplift," "DNA" and "Terraforming" classes. In the course of a round, each player picks one "action" from '''Exploring''', '''Developing''', '''Settling''', '''Trading''', '''Consuming''' or '''Producing.''' Since if one player builds or settles his twelfth item in his turn, the game ends, it's vital, come the end of the game, to avoid allowing your opponent to do that. Equally, it's important to stop one player quietly Consuming and then Producing every turn to steal all the money in the universe. However, the game is mostly played to get you points, not to stop others from winning (this is where it differs from something like [[Munchkin]]) and you would do best to try and get similar cards that work well with your 6-cost cards (for example, "New Galactic Order" adds one point to your score for every point of military force you own.
